What Exactly Is Flavored Vodka?
Flavored vodka is like the pop star of the liquor world—relishing the spotlight by taking a classic staple and giving it a modern twist. At its core, vodka is a distilled spirit that tends to be flavor neutral. However, modern mixologists and beverage innovators have infused vodka with an array of flavors, from tangy citrus, smooth vanilla, spicy pepper, to even quirky options like cucumber or watermelon. These exciting twists not only enhance its palatability for sippers but also open up a world of creative cocktail recipes.
For the curious and calorie-conscious, the question isn’t just about taste—it’s about understanding how these flavor-enhancing ingredients affect the carb count. While traditional vodka is celebrated for its minimal carbohydrate content, the addition of natural or artificial flavorings and sugars can sometimes add an unexpected carbohydrate load.

Decoding Carbs: The Nuts and Bolts of Vodka Nutrition
Let’s talk numbers. In the realm of alcohol, especially vodka, carbohydrates generally come from the sugars used in flavoring. Traditional or unflavored vodka, because of its rigorous distillation process, virtually contains zero carbs. But once you add fruit extracts, syrups, or other additives to create that signature flavor, you might be penciling in a few extra carbs per serving.
Here’s a quick snapshot: although the base spirit remains low-carb, some flavored vodkas might hover between 0 to 5 carbs per 1.5-ounce serving—but don’t be fooled, as the figure can climb higher if the flavors are derived from sugary infusions. Navigating the Science: How Carbs End Up in Your Flavored Vodka
When you hear “carbs in flavored vodka,” it might sound like a chemistry experiment set to explode. In reality, the process is surprisingly straightforward. Reputable distillers start with a neutral vodka base—typically distilled from grains or potatoes. When it comes time to add flavor, creative techniques come into play:
- Natural Infusions: Using fruits, herbs, or spices can introduce a small number of naturally-occurring sugars. Think about how a lemon twist might lend zesty notes but also hint at a sugary price.
- Artificial Flavors: These are lab-created molecules designed to mimic natural flavors without necessarily adding carbs. They’re a win for taste and low-carb lifestyles if produced correctly.
- Syrups & Extracts: Some producers choose to add a touch of sweetness using syrups or extracts, which can bump up the carbohydrate count. If a flavor bursts with sugar, so might its carb value.
The key takeaway is that while the vodka itself retains its reputation as a low-carb option, the added ingredients in the flavoring process can contribute small amounts of carbohydrates. Crunching the Numbers: How Many Carbs Are in Your Flavored Vodka?
The million-dollar question: just how many carbs are we talking about? While the exact number can vary widely depending on the brand and flavor profile, here are some general guidelines to keep in mind:
- Unflavored Vodka: Typically 0 carbs. Pure and simple.
- Lightly Flavored Vodka: Often ranging between 1-3 grams of carbs per 1.5-ounce serving. These are usually crafted using natural infusions that add just a hint of sweetness.
- Heavily Flavored or Sweeter Varieties: These can clock in at up to 5 grams or more per serving, particularly if sugary syrups or extracts are used.
It’s essential to check the label and manufacturer’s notes or a trusted nutrition guide if you’re tracking your macro intake meticulously. Trust us—the little numbers matter when you’re trying to balance fun with fitness.

Factors That Influence the Carb Content in Flavored Vodka
Not all flavored vodkas are created equal, and several factors can influence their carbohydrate count. Understanding these variables is like decoding a secret recipe for responsibly indulging in your favorite drink:
The Flavoring Method
As mentioned earlier, the method used to infuse flavor plays a decisive role. Natural infusions tend to introduce fewer carbs compared to flavored vodkas sweetened with additional syrups. Check the ingredients list—if you see sugars or syrups, you might be looking at a higher carb content.
Quality and Production Techniques
Premium brands often invest in advanced purification and distillation processes that remove excess sugars during production. These vodkas aim to maintain maximum purity while still delivering that flavorful punch. So often, those high-end bottles are an excellent choice for the health-conscious drinker.
Portion Size and Serving Style
The way you enjoy your vodka matters, too. A standard shot is 1.5 ounces, but many trendy cocktails call for more generous pours or even multiple servings combined in one glass. Always keep an eye on your portion size—because when you’re celebrating, those carbs can sneak up on you.
Mixers and Cocktail Additions
Let’s be real; vodka rarely gets served alone. The mixers, juices, sodas, and even garnishes you add can significantly escalate the carb count in your drink. Sugar-laden mixers can turn a low-carb vodka into a calorie-packed cocktail. For example, a splash of cranberry juice might sound refreshing—until you realize it’s packing extra carbohydrates.

Tips for Low-Carb Drinking Without Compromising Flavor
If you're committed to a low-carb lifestyle but don't want to give up the pleasure of a well-made cocktail, here are some tips to keep your drinking game strong—and carb-friendly:
- Know Your Labels: Always check the nutritional information. Research online or use dedicated apps that break down the carb content of your favorite flavored vodkas.
- Stick to Standard Servings: Keep your portions in check. A standard 1.5-ounce shot is ideal, but avoid overly generous pours that might secretly add extra carbs.
- Choose Low-Carb Mixers: Replace sugary mixes with soda water, lemon-lime soda (diet versions), or unsweetened iced tea to keep your drink light.
- DIY Infusions: Experiment at home by infusing your own vodka with fresh fruits or herbs. This way, you control the ingredients and the carb content.
- Moderation is Key: Even if a flavored vodka has a few extra carbs, enjoying it in moderation will ensure your overall carb count stays on track.
- Stay Hydrated: Alcohol dehydrates, so alternate drinks with water to help your metabolism work efficiently and prevent a hangover (both physical and carb-related!).

Cocktail Creativity: Low-Carb Recipes to Try Now
Ready to get creative? Here are a few low-carb cocktail recipes that let you savor all the flavors of your favorite vodka, minus the carb overload:
The Classic Vodka Soda with a Twist
A timeless favorite: mix 1.5 ounces of your preferred flavored vodka with soda water, a squeeze of fresh lime, and a sprig of mint. The result is a crisp, refreshing cocktail that’s practically carb-free and totally Instagram-worthy.
Bubbly Berry Delight
Combine 1.5 ounces of lightly berry-infused vodka, a splash of unsweetened cranberry extract, soda water, and an assortment of fresh raspberries. Stir gently to let the flavors marry in a glass that’s cool enough for any millennial brunch.
Citrus Splash Martini
For those who crave a little elegance, shake 2 ounces of citrus-flavored vodka with ice, a dash of lemon juice, and a twist of orange zest. Strain into a chilled martini glass and garnish with an orange peel for a cocktail that’s as sophisticated as it is carb-conscious.

FAQs: Your Burning Questions on Flavored Vodka and Carbs Answered
We know you have questions. Below are some of the most frequently asked questions about flavored vodka, its carb content, and how it fits into a balanced lifestyle.
1. Does all flavored vodka contain carbs?
No, not all flavored vodka contains carbs. Unflavored vodka is typically carb-free since it’s highly distilled. However, flavored variants that incorporate natural fruit extracts or added sugars can have a small carb count—usually ranging from 1 to 5 grams per 1.5-ounce serving.
2. How do I know which flavored vodka is low-carb?
Check the ingredients list and nutritional info on the bottle or the brand’s website. Vodkas that use artificial flavoring or natural infusions without added sweeteners often have lower carbs.
3. Can mixing vodka with certain ingredients increase my carb count?
Absolutely. Using sugary mixers like regular sodas or sweetened juices can spike the carb content of your cocktail. Opt for zero-carb or low-carb mixers like soda water or unsweetened iced tea instead.
4. Is a flavored vodka soda a low-carb option?
Yes, a classic vodka soda made with a flavored vodka that’s low in carbs and topped with soda water and fresh citrus is typically one of the best low-carb choices.
5. How important is it to track the carbs in my drinks?
For those monitoring their macros, every gram counts. Tracking your carb intake helps you enjoy your cocktails without derailing your nutrition goals.
6. Do premium brands offer lower-carb flavored options?
Many premium brands invest in quality production and advanced distillation, thereby minimizing extra sugars in their flavored vodkas. However, always review the nutritional details to be sure.
7. Can I make my own flavored vodka at home to control the carb content?
Yes! DIY flavored vodka allows you to choose fresh ingredients and avoid added sugars, letting you maintain control over the final carb count.
8. How does alcohol metabolism affect my overall carb intake?
Alcohol is processed differently in your body and can disrupt normal metabolic processes. While vodka itself might be low-carb, be mindful of how it affects your blood sugar and overall metabolism.
9. What are some alternatives for a low-carb cocktail?
Consider cocktails that use unsweetened mixers, fresh herbs, and citrus juices, or even try a neat pour of your favorite low-carb flavored vodka.
10. Is spending more on flavored vodka worth the low-carb benefits?
Quality often comes at a price, and many higher-end brands offer lower-carb options with a smoother, more refined taste. Ultimately, it depends on your personal priorities and taste preferences.
